Question
Express the following in standard form: Express $2$ years in seconds.

Answer

Given,
$2$ year $= 2 \times 365$ days [$\because$
$1$ yr $= 365$ days approx.)
$= 2 \times 365 \times 24h$ [$\because$ 1 day = 24h]
$= 2 \times 365 \times 24 \times 60$ min [$\because$ 1 h = 60 min]
$= 2 \times 365 \times 24 \times 60 \times 60s$ [$\because 1$ min $= 60 s)$
$= 63072000s$
